Romney was asked how he could combat illegal
immigration, find illegals when he can’t even find the illegals on his
front lawn. Romney sticks to amnesty is not the anwer.
Guliani’s
previous statement, pro-illegal immigration was asked. Guliani states
that he’s not against reporting of illegals to the police. He says his
strategy was to combat crime and allow illegals to report crime and
help legals.
McCain answers the illegal immigration by saying
amnesty is not the answer. Why current policy push failed is due to
current failing policies. Says he can secure the borders. Says Romney
did have the same ideas.
Huckabee is asked about the issue of
racism and illegal immigrations. He says the people aren’t angry at
immgrants, they’re angry at the broken border. Says we should
outsource to UPS/FedEx as they have better tracking system. Says he’s
not angry at immigrants.
Tancredo of course is asked this next.
The one issue candidate says this is the most important issue. Says the
rest of the candidates were silent for a long time, and had their
fingers in the wind. Says its got nothing to do with disliking anyone
but its about the rule of law.
Hunter answers to his idea of a
fence. He says he built the double fence in San Diego that is
effectively keeping people out and the fence is now law.
Guliani and McCain is asked of ICE issue. Guliani Says
reality is physical fence won’t solve it, but need a technological
fence, and need I’d card. Want to encourage legal immigrations.
McCain
says amnesty is “forgiveness” but the proposed reform will impose fines
and penalties. Mentioned he was in Bagdad over July 4th and that
soldiers were green card holders fighting there.
Romney says the
bill is amnesty. Fence is broken. Need to end sancuary city and stop
funding. Need to sanction employers. That will end amnesty.

The question now is on presidential power. Romney says
the focus should be on preventing terrorist attacks. Needs to track and
follow and needs to wiretap mosque and church. Says the most important
civil liberty is the right to be kept alive.
Tancredo is asked
iftheres a line he won’t cross, including torture. Tank says how do we
define torture. In a word, he believe in torture to get intel in the
name of national security.
McCain is asked to respond to Tancredo. McCain says intel obtained can never
counterbalance
our reputation and using it as an excuse to torture our people. He
says those who support torture usually don’t have military experience.
Guliani says we can close Gitmo becuase no one else wants these people.

Next question is on tax reform. Asking McCain won’t
pledge not to raise taxes. McCain points to his record of not raising
taxes. He says we need to stop letting spending get out of control.
McCain points to law makers in prision now on corruption charges.
McCain says he doesn’t need to sign pledges.
Brownback is asked
to respond. He says McCain should sign. He says we are taxed too much.
Need to grow economy. Why aren’t they discussing outsourcing?
Guliani
called to task on raising tax in NYC. Also he didn’t sign pledge.
Guliani says as president take pne pledge to uphold constitution. Will
not make pledge on every issue. Good answer!
Romney took pledge.
Yet he raised fees for the blind, gun-owner, etc. Use to be called
“fee-fee”. He points to the Dem state of MA wanted to raise taxes, and
he said no way. Says he lowered taxes. Wants to eliminate capital gains
tax.
Huckabee’s fair tax proposal will only benefit the two ends
but not in the middle. He says he wants to eliminate penalty on earning
but on consumption including prostitution, etc. I like it.
Paul
says cut both taxes and spending. Wants to get rid of CIA, DHS,etc.
Paul says prior to 9/11 we were spending billions. We need to eliminate
bureaucracy. We need to have intelligent people in intelligence. Says
we should not sacrafic liberty for security we loose both!!! I’m
liking him more and more.

Next question is on Iran. Asking how theywoulddealwith iran.
Paul
says president doesn’t have the power to go to war. Needs to go to
Congress. Should be talking to Iran not looking for a scenerio to
attack them. We don’t have to resort to war everytime. Israel can take
care of themselves.
Tancredo is asked about Israel’s statement
that they won’t wait on Iran. Tancredo says he will look at the people
of Iran. Can’t push a button for war but can’t back down. Everyone is
being politically correct because its getting us killed.
Hunter
doesn’t want to answer a hypothetical (he ought to be defense
secretary) yet he offers some consideration. Can’t allow iran to have
nuclear device and would have to ensure they don’t have weapons grade,
need ground force assessment after a strike.
Huckebee says president ought to uphold constitution and his own conscience.
Brownback is in favor of attack Iran. Need to go after military forces. Great, suit him up.
Guliani
says we need to look at iran differently from cold war prespective as
they are supplying terrorists right now. Need clear position that Iran
cannot go nuclear. Highlights McCain’s and highlights Reagan’s win of
cold war without firing a shot but pointing a thousand missiles at the
soviets.
